I have some problems with Whole Foods, namely their ridiculous markups and their questionable marketing and business practices. Fortunately I belong to a coop so I can get organic, local produce at reasonable prices and I don't have to deal with Whole Foods.

Reply to This

What are some of their questionable marketing and business practices?

What do you mean by markups? Last time I was at Westerley's, they were even more expensive.

Reply to This

I'm not familiar with Westerley's prices, but Whole Foods will often mark produce up to 50% over suggested retail price. At my coop we mark everything up to 30% over wholesale, which is less than suggested retail. If something costs $1 wholesale at the coop we would charge $1.30 for it, Whole Foods might well charge $2.00 or more.

The problem I have with their marketing is that they basically sell stuff by appealing to people's ethics. You go to Whole Foods and you see the sign about "Tom the Apple Farmer" down the road right next to apples that were actually shipped from Costa Rica.

It boils down to the fact that Whole Foods is basically a corporation and their goal is to make a profit. A quick Google yields the following:
